442 JOURNAL OF PROCEEDINGS [Mar. 12,

Also, favorably,

House bill entitled an Act to more effectually protect trav-
ellers against the payment of illegal tolls, which may be

charged by any of the several Turnpike Companies chartered
under the Act of 1804, Chapter 51, or any supplement
thereto.

Which was read the second time.

Also, favorably,

House bill entitled an Act to authorize the Mayor and City

Council of Baltimore to purchase the whole or any part of
the second preferred mortgage bonds and coupons of the
Western Maryland Railroad Company, and fund certificates
representing such coupons, and to issue its stock or certifi-
cate of indebtedness, so far as may be necessary for the said

object, to an amount not exceeding the sum of $400,000.

Whicb was read the second time.

Also, favorably,

House bill entitled an Act to repeal Sections 7, 10, 11, 13,
14, 16 and 21, Chapter 77, of the Acts of the General As-
sembly, passed at January Session, 1870, entitled an Act to
incorporate the town of Frostburg, in Allegany County, and
re-enact the same with amendments, and to add two addi-
tional sections thereto, number 34 and 35.

Which was read the second time.

Also, favorably,

Senate bill entitled an Act to authorize the construction
;and maintenance of a line of telegraph from the House of
Correction, at Jessup's Station, in Anne Arundel County, to
the Police Headquarters in Baltimore City, from the House
of Refuge, in Baltimore City, and from the State Peniten-
tiary, to the Police Headquarters in Baltimore City.

Which was read the first time.

Also, reported

House bill entitled an Act to give additional corporate
powers to the House of the Good Shepherd of the City of
Baltimore, and to provide for the commitments thereto of dis-
olute and disorderly females, for the purpose of reformation,

With the following proposed amendment :
AMENDMENT PROPOSED.

Strike out all after the word "for," in Section 8, line 6,
and insert "the sum of fifteen hundred dollars on each of the
days aforesaid."
